The 2022 WNBA season highlighted the former player-to-coach pipeline

Becky Hammon simply ended up being the very first head coach in WNBA history to win a champion in her launching season as a head coach. Technically, Van Chancellor likewise did so in 1997, however that was the WNBA’s very first year, and Chancellor had actually been working as a head coach for several years prior to that, simply not at the expert level.

Hammon likewise ended up being the 2nd individual in league history to win a title as a head coach after playing in the WNBA, signing up with Sandy Brondello, though Hammon is the very first to do so with the franchise she bet. The player-coach pipeline is something the league intentionally worked to broaden recently, and in 2022, that pipeline has actually had its crowning minute.

Half of the WNBA’s 12 groups used a previous gamer as head coach this season. The 6 overall coaches (Brondello, Hammon, Vickie Johnson, Vanessa Nygaard, Noelle Quinn, and Tanisha Wright) were without a doubt the most in league history; the WNBA had as lots of as 16 groups, however the variety of previous gamers inhabiting the head training ranks has actually never ever gone beyond 3 prior to this season.

Becky Hammon took on versus another previous gamer turned head coach in the preliminary of the 2022 playoffs, Vanessa Nygaard, by the way helped by another previous gamer, Crystal Robinson.
Photo by Chris Coduto/Getty Images

Two years back, the league executed a guideline that permitted groups to bring 3 assistant coaches rather of 2, offered among the coaches was a previous gamer, and the dominos have actually been falling rapidly since. Of the gamer head coaches in 2022, 5 of them were WNBA assistants initially, and 4 held that function within the last 2 seasons.

“I know for me, it’s something and others in this league, that we have asked for, as women, as women of color that we didn’t understand the lack of representation for years,” Minnesota head coach Cheryl Reeve stated. “And we sort of had to kind of kick and scream about it and pull it to where it is. And it happened fast.”

At her pre-Finals interview, commissioner Cathy Engelbert kept in mind that it was a top priority to increase the variety of front workplaces, and part of that effort includes getting gamers in management positions.

“One of the things we do at every Board of Governors meeting that we have with our WNBA ownership groups is talk about the diversity of our front office and our back office because we are extremely diverse in the player ranks, and again, I am really proud that now we have six our of 12 of our head coaches are coaches of color and seven out of 12 of our coaches are women,” Engelbert stated. “I think there are only a few when I came into the league. So just that constant focus, and this is the owners. The owners are stepping up and making sure that their focus is on diversity.”

Another person who Reeve thinks should have credit is Bill Laimbeer for being among the leaders of having previous gamers on his training bench. Three 2022 head coaches were assistants for Laimbeer on the Aces: Johnson in Dallas, Wright in Atlanta, and Nygaard in Phoenix; that doesn’t even consist of Katie Smith, who made her very first head training task for the Liberty after finding out as an assistant under Laimbeer in New York.

Bill Laimbeer had 3 previous gamer assistant coaches in 2021: Tanisha Wright, Vanessa Nygaard, and Sugar Rodgers. Two have actually currently gone on to end up being head coaches.

Getting gamers in those seats on the bench puts them initially in line when head training positions open, something Reeve saw when her male assistants rapidly got poached for the huge task.

“With the Lynx. I had hired a couple of men, one was a black man, one was a white man,” Reeve stated. “James (Wade) was incredibly qualified when he got his opportunity. It was a no-brainer. It was a great situation for him, and look how well he’s done. But my other assistant coach was nowhere near as qualified as many people, many women. And if the qualifications were as low as they were for that hire, then there was a lot of people that were qualified for that position, and so I think it was a real eye-opener for me. I understood, that what I do, you know, but that was really eye-opening, I gotta tell you. I had two men, and I’m going bang bang, they were able to get opportunities. And so we committed to hiring women. And so Katie and Plenette (Pierson), Plenette moved on to the college game, but Katie, Plenette, and Rebekkah (Brunson). If it stood to reason that James and Walt could get a job so quickly, well then they’re the next people up, so let’s see what happens.”

As Reeve awaits her personnel to reach their next actions, she and coaches around the league are thrilled by the ladies who have actually currently made the dive. Brondello informed Swish Appeal it provides her delight as a previous gamer to see her fellow sistren getting these chances. Mystics head coach Mike Thibault stated it was healthy for the league to have more youthful coaches who are “open to a lot of ideas”.

Chicago head coach James Wade — who wished to highlight that he belongs with this new age of more youthful coaches due to the fact that he was a practice gamer and is wed to a previous WNBA gamer, Edwige Lawson-Wade — believes that having coaches who have actually even had fun with the gamers they are training makes the relationship more of a collaboration, which assists them inspire their gamers and highlight the very best in them.

It makes good sense, then, that gamers are likewise on board with this working with pattern due to the fact that it assists them get in touch with their coaches. As 2022 MVP A’ja Wilson informed Bleacher Report, “[Hammon] can relate to us because she sat in that locker room before, and she knows how it feels in a timeout during a clutch game.” Sabrina Ionescu, who remains in her very first year playing under Brondello after 2 years with Walt Hopkins, shared a comparable belief with Swish Appeal.

“I think that’s really helped just having a coach that has played at the highest level and knows kind of the ins and outs of what it feels like, practice, when you lose, when you win,” the Liberty All-Star stated. “People from the outside don’t know really what it feels like, going through wins, losses, facing adversity, even on an individual level, like a player level, with pressure and dealing with injuries and all that stuff if you haven’t really gone through it. So I think it does definitely help and just adds to why [Brondello]’s such a great coach in this league.”

Kayla Thornton, who played the last 2 seasons under Johnson in Dallas, included that in addition to sensation comfy being coached by VJ, it’s a brilliant area for the league as an entire to develop area for its previous gamers. Considering the monetary truth of being a female expert athlete, belonging to go back to post-retirement is helpful on numerous fronts.

“I think it’s good, especially for women, that we’re able to know that once we’re done playing we can also come back, we have another platform to come back and to give back to what our teachers taught us, our coaches, and come back to the WNBA and be able to work and still be in the WNBA family,” Thornton stated.

That sensation of belonging to the WNBA household becomes part of what drew Hammon back to the league, even after she was working towards making a head training task in the NBA.

“Obviously, the WNBA is home for all of us, and so when we come back to it, it feels like home, it feels natural,” Hammon stated after winning 2022 coach of the year. “For me, having been gone for eight years, and being able to learn under arguably the greatest coach ever, just really helped give me a really good foundation to come back and give back and invest not only in the WNBA, but invest in my players individually, collectively. So it’s been a really fun journey for me. I’ve said this before, but this is one of the best decisions I ever made was to come here and coach these women.”

But while Hammon was established for success in Las Vegas with a previous MVP in Wilson; 3 Olympians in Chelsea Gray, Kelsey Plum, and Jackie Young; a two-time previous 6th gamer of the year, Dearica Hamby; and an owner that invested as much as possible into the coach and the rest of the franchise, other coaches don’t land in the exact same safeguard.

Johnson is out after 2 years in Dallas where the president of basketball operations goes through coaches like water. Nygaard dealt with more barriers than any first-year coach in any sport in current memory even omitting the wrongful detention of Brittney Griner, as she needed to browse a power battle in between her 2 finest gamers, and handle a previous super star who asked out, all while the group’s owner was being examined for unsuitable conduct. Wright and Quinn appear safe in the meantime, however even Seattle remains in a precarious position with just 2 gamers under agreement for next season.

“I think it’s wonderful for the league. There is tremendous x’s and o’s knowledge by these elite players, and to have a path to stay involved in this league is a great thing in the long run for our league,” Connecticut head coach Curt Miller stated. “I just hope that franchises, our league does the right thing and prepare them for opportunities and not propel them before they’re ready because then they could all of sudden lose out if they don’t have instant success. There’s not great security in this league. And so it’s really exciting, but, you know, I’m included. We need to prepare this next wave of players transitioning from the court playing side to the coaching sidelines.”

There are presently 3 head training positions open for the 2023 season (Dallas, Indiana, and Los Angeles) and possibly another 2 on the horizon in 2024 if 2 growth groups do certainly concerned the WNBA. That implies increasingly more chances for previous gamers to get a shot in a brand-new function.

Hammon has actually shown that previous gamers can stand out at this task when offered the possibility with a champion in her very first season, not to point out a Commissioner’s Cup title, All-Star video game triumph, and no. 1 general seed. Quinn had the Storm playing along with anybody at the end of the season, and nobody would have been amazed had her team handled to knock off the Aces in the WNBA semifinals. Wright was 2nd in coach of the year ballot and gamers have actually been lavishing her with appreciation in her novice project.

Their success recommends that the league ought to have been welcoming its base of previous gamers for a long period of time. No time like today for franchises presently looking for brand-new management.

“It’s great to see and you know, frankly, it’s about time,” Reeve stated. “We should celebrate it, yes. At the same time, it kind of goes with what should have been happening. So we got to make sure that we’re continuing to move in that direction. And it’s great for everyone. It’s great for players to be led by women and women of color. Everyone’s talked about that. You know, I don’t think it’s about excluding anyone. It’s just more about there’s been so few opportunities, and now we’re finally getting to a place where we’re a little more represented, which is great.”
